ATK GT
Brake fluid capacity & service interval
ATK GT uses brake fluid with a capacity range of 0.5 to 1.0 liters. Service intervals require a change every 24 months. The data covers 3 configurations.

Additional Notes
- The ATK GT lineup covering the GT 250, GT 250 R, and GT 650 R all share a hydraulic brake system, which means brake fluid is pressurized to actuate the calipers rather than relying on mechanical linkage.
- Across all three variants spanning 2011-2017, the fill level specification is expressed as a range between a minimum and maximum mark rather than a fixed volume, which is standard practice for hydraulic brake reservoirs where precise milliliter quantities are less relevant than maintaining fluid within the sight window.
- The 24-month change interval applies under normal use conditions for the GT 250, GT 250 R, and GT 650 R alike, meaning brake fluid replacement is time-based rather than mileage-based across the entire GT range covered here.
- A time-based interval of 24 months reflects the hygroscopic nature of brake fluid, which absorbs moisture from the atmosphere over time and lowers its boiling point regardless of how many kilometers have been ridden.
- The identical service interval and fill specification across the 250cc and 650cc engine displacements indicates that displacement alone does not alter the brake fluid maintenance schedule within the ATK GT series for 2011-2017.
